We have purchased several of the 200 packs of bags. Repeat customer, need I say more? Well, I will. We have never had a bag fail from the factory seams. It is convenient to not have to cut off the roll then seal the bottom. All of our orders have gotten here fast. I like that you can microwave or boil in the bag. If you can just seal, not vacuum. It is good to put can of corn, seal it. Then just boil at camp. No pot to clean! I also marinate the same way.

I have used this brand in the past and was satisfied; however this review reflects the condition of the bags I just received. All 100 bags were curled upwards at the open end making them almost impossible to seal. When I trimmed off an inch, even that didn't help. It appears the packaging was crushed on one end and that "set" the curl into the plastic. My advice is to inspect your purchase immediately and return them if this happens to you.
